mysql获取字符串中多个数值的最大值

MySql 码拜 9年前 (2016-01-28) 1673次浏览
如数据
YJV-3*50+1*25 取最大值50
JKLGYJ-1-120/20 取最大值120
YJV-4*70+1*35 取最大值70
利用数据库自带函数或本人建立函数或其它方法实现都可以
望大家多多帮助
解决方案:15分
这个建议本人写存储过程来实现。 在存储过程对对字符串逐字分析即可。
解决方案:15分
记录不多,在数据库里处理还行,  假如数据量大了, 你放数据库来分析, 估计够呛
解决方案:20分
你先建个表,输入 *,-,/ 等字符,然后按照这些字符来拆分字符串,取得数值,然后求出最大的数字是多少

CodeBye 版权所有丨如未注明 , 均为原创丨本网站采用BY-NC-SA协议进行授权 , 转载请注明mysql获取字符串中多个数值的最大值
喜欢 (0)
[1034331897@qq.com]
分享 (0)